Long-term unemployment by sex - annual data in Switzerland, 2010–2025
Source: Eurostat. Measured in Thousand persons.
Analysis
The most recent figure for long-term unemployment by sex - annual data in Switzerland is 74 Thousand persons, measured in 2025.
The figure is up 5.7% on the previous year and down 11.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, long-term unemployment by sex - annual data in Switzerland peaked at 94 Thousand persons in 2021 and was at its lowest, 65 Thousand persons, in 2023.
Switzerland ranks 17th of 43 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Long-term unemployment by sex - annual data in Switzerland, year by year
| Year | Thousand persons |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 71 Thousand persons | — |
| 2011 | 72 Thousand persons | +1.4% |
| 2012 | 67 Thousand persons | -6.9% |
| 2013 | 68 Thousand persons | +1.5% |
| 2014 | 81 Thousand persons | +19.1% |
| 2015 | 84 Thousand persons | +3.7% |
| 2016 | 86 Thousand persons | +2.4% |
| 2017 | 81 Thousand persons | -5.8% |
| 2018 | 85 Thousand persons | +4.9% |
| 2019 | 74 Thousand persons | -12.9% |
| 2020 | 76 Thousand persons | +2.7% |
| 2021 | 94 Thousand persons | +23.7% |
| 2022 | 74 Thousand persons | -21.3% |
| 2023 | 65 Thousand persons | -12.2% |
| 2024 | 70 Thousand persons | +7.7% |
| 2025 | 74 Thousand persons | +5.7% |
